* Set the METEOR flowgraph in non-X mode
* Reduce the stored bandwidth by a factor of 2. Captures have shown that
twice the bandwidth of the METEOR is enough for RRC and clock recovery
This commit adds a inital METEOR flowgraph that can be used for
capturing raw IQ. The capturing is performed in a sampling rate of
320KSPS which is more than enough for actual decoding for both METEOR
modes (72K and 80K). Due to icnreased bandwidth no audio file is
generated.
